What is a megapascal?

A million pascals. Concrete strength and hydraulic ratings are specified here: 30 MPa concrete is about 4,350 psi.

What is an inch of mercury?

The pressure of a one-inch column of mercury at 0 °C, fixed by convention at 3,386.389 pascals. US aviation altimeters and barometers read in it.
